For this card I chose this adorable little mouse from Unity Stamps,  Spring Mouse

Since this is just an inspiration point I decided to add another color, (green) to my card.  After all this is a Spring mouse!

My card stock colors: Basic White, Granny Apple Green & Azure Afternoon - SU.

The image was stamped in Memento Tuxedo black ink and colored with pencils blended with Gamsol.
I masked off the mouse image and created clouds by using a homemade stencil since I couldn't find my cloud stencil (my craft room needs serious organization!)

As you can see it's not perfect, I'm still learning stencil techniques.
I colored the border and drew in grass with my pencils.  Then I stamped rain using an old SU stamp from Itty Bitty Backgrounds.

The dies are Unity (Rectangle Scallops and Circles). Main image was mounted with foam tape.
